How much is Road Rash II worth on Sega Mega Drive? This price guide tracks new, used and sealed prices for this 1992 Racing release, with recent price trends. In UK / PAL it currently values around £26 new and £15 used, with a MyPlayersVault collector score of 52 (HIGH-ALPHA tier). Sealed value is up 7% over the past 1 month. Import copies in Japan & Asia (NTSC-J) trade around £151.

Road Rash II on Mega Drive represents a legacy arcade-racing franchise entry with genuine collector identity rooted in platform nostalgia and regional scarcity. The Tec Toy UK-PAL release introduces publisher-variant specificity that distinguishes this from mass-market Genesis copies, creating meaningful collector differentiation. Sealed condition examples circulate with moderate frequency among Mega Drive specialists, reflecting niche but sustained demand within the retro racing community. The title carries cult status within its platform ecosystem without commanding premium positioning, positioning it as a solid discovery for collectors building comprehensive Mega Drive libraries rather than a headline acquisition.
